Van Rooyen Family Foundation is a private foundation foc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in WILSON, WY. IRS filing data is available for 2020. As of 2020, the organization holds $4.4M in total assets. In 2020, it awarded 3 grants totaling $308K. Net investment income was $82K.

Among its reported 2020 grants, the largest include Far Hills Country Day School ($198,260), Delbarton School ($100,000), Georgetown University ($10,000).
| Recipient | Purpose | Amount |
|---|---|---|
| FAR HILLS COUNTRY DAY SCHOOL FAR HILLS, NJ | TO SUPPORT ACADEMIC EXCELLENCE AND CHARATER DEVELOPMENT TO PROMOTE CHILDREN'S SUCCESS IN THE MODERN WORLD. | $198,260 |
| GEORGETOWN UNIVERSITY WASHINGTON, DC | TO SUPPORT THE OLDEST CATHOLIC AND JESUIT INSTITUTION OF HIGHER LEARNING IN THE UNITED STATES. | $10,000 |
| DELBARTON SCHOOL MORRISTOWN, NJ | TO SUPPORT AN INDEPENDENT, BENEDICTINE, CATHOLIC COLLEGE PREPARATORY SCHOOL FOR YOUNG MEN THAT SEEKS TO DEVELOP THE WHOLE PERSON BOTH AS A CREATURE OF MIND, BODY AND SPIRIT, AND AS A MEMBER OF A COMMUNITY. | $100,000 |
